Baby Care: How To Diaper Babies?

Baby Diaper
Changing diapers is also a skill as your baby shouldn't feel the discomfort in the process. It should be easy, fast and not too disturbing for the infant. Today, we have planned to help all the just mommies and daddies to take a good care of their babies and enjoy the stage. Take a look.

It is not very difficult if you plan to become an expert baby diaper changer. You need to first prepare yourself for diapering like wash hands well with an anti bacterial and germ free soap. The next thing would be maintaining a bag or a basket for baby diaper items like diaper cover, pins, waterproof pants, talcum powder/ baby powder, baby wipes, cotton, towels, hand sanitizers etc.

Keep the basket or bag away from the baby's reach as he may chew or open all that he finds. Here are the baby diapering steps.

1. You need to first make your baby feel that changing diapers is fun. Sing songs and give him toys so that he keeps playing while you are busy wrapping him with the new one.

2. The umbilical cord needs to fall off so until then fold the diaper in a way where the area is exposed and dry.

3. Dispose the used diaper by folding and retaping it in a plastic bag. Store the used ones in the closed garbage bin so that your baby cannot see or open it.

4. Now wash your hands well again so that it prevents the baby from any kind of infection. Never leave the pins or open bottles near baby as he may meddle when you are away.

5. Using baby wipes, clean the diaper area well and apply powder to prevent rashes that happen due to dampness. You can also use a wet cotton to get rid of the feces and urine.

6. Do not wrap the new diaper too tight as it may irritate the baby's skin. If you are using a cotton cloth as a diaper then wrap it in such a way that baby can comfortably move. See to it you have thicker layer on the peeing area (for boys on the penis). These simple steps are good baby care tips too.

Now use a hand sanitizer to clean hands and baby diapering is done.
